United Group Еnters into Bulgarian Renewable Energy Market with an Investment of EUR 120 million in Three Solar Photovoltaic (PV) Power Plants and One Wind Farm

/SOFIA, January 22, 2025, 10:00 GMT, RENEWABLE MARKET WATCHTM/ By 2027, these projects will provide 160% of the electricity needed for the Group's operations in Bulgaria. They will meet 65% of the Group's total electricity demand, eliminating approximately 120,000 tonnes of carbon dioxide emissions from the electricity grid in Bulgaria each year. Together, the projects will have a total installed capacity of 124 MW and an annual generation of 310,000 MWh - enough to power over 60,000 households yearly.
